The inaugural IPL champions Rajasthan Royals have dealt with a blow ahead of their preparations for the upcoming IPL 2025 season. The Rajasthan Royals are tirelessly training hard in their pre-season camp ahead of their opening match slated for 23rd March against Sunrisers Hyderabad at the Rajiv Gandhi Stadium in Hyderabad.
The team is sweating it out in the training camp, but the in-charge is missing. Yes, you heard it right! Rahul Dravid the head coach of Rajasthan Royals isn’t present in the camp due to an injury.

Rahul Dravid nursing a leg injury
RR’s Head Coach Rahul Dravid suffered a leg injury while playing cricket in Bengaluru, as confirmed by the franchise. On its official X handle, RR posted a picture of Rahul Dravid sitting on a chair with a cast on his left leg. The post read,
“Head Coach Rahul Dravid, who picked up an injury while playing Cricket in Bangalore, is recovering well and will join us today in Jaipur,”

When will Rahul Dravid join the Rajasthan Royals camp?
Fans don’t need to get tensed much as Rajasthan Royals’ head coach Rahul Dravid will re-join the squad today itself. This will be a huge sigh of relief for the players. Rahul’s keen eye on the preparations ahead of RR’s opening clash against Sunrisers Hyderabad would be vital.

Rajasthan Royals IPL 2025 Squad: Sanju Samson (C/WK), Yashasvi Jaiswal, Riyan Parag, Dhruv Jurel (WK), Shimron Hetmyer, Sandeep Sharma, Jofra Archer, Maheesh Theekshana, Akash Madhwal, Kumar Kartikeya, Kunal Rathore, Ashok Sharma, Nitish Rana, Tushar Deshpande, Shubham Dubey, Wanindu Hasaranga, Yudhvir Singh, Fazalhaq Farooqi, Vaibhav Suryavanshi, Kwena Maphaka.
